The environmental impact of septic systems is a rising concern in each urban and rural settings. While these techniques are sometimes viewed as a convenient alternative to centralized sewage treatment, they'll pose significant risks to native ecosystems if not correctly maintained. Understanding the implications of septic systems is crucial for householders, policymakers, and environmental advocates who search sustainable solutions for waste administration.


Septic systems perform by treating family wastewater on-site, permitting for the pure filtration of contaminants through soil layers. Nevertheless, they'll turn into sources of groundwater pollution if designed or managed inadequately. When a septic system fails, untreated waste can seep into the groundwater, probably contaminating consuming water provides and harming aquatic ecosystems.


Many components contribute to the effectiveness of septic techniques, together with soil type, system design, and maintenance practices. Sandy soils, for instance, facilitate better drainage and waste breakdown than clay soils, which may retain water and result in system failure. Subsequently, web site assessments are important in the course of the planning phase of septic system installation to ensure compatibility with local environmental circumstances.

Common maintenance is also a critical part to mitigate adverse environmental impacts. Owners must pump their septic tanks often to prevent overflows and backups. Neglecting this maintenance may end up in untreated waste being released into the encompassing environment. Sadly, many householders are unaware of those requirements or delay maintenance till problems arise, growing the chance of environmental contamination.


The distance between a septic system and consuming water sources is one other essential consideration. Regulations typically dictate minimal setback distances to reduce back the danger of contamination; nonetheless, many older systems have been installed without adherence to modern requirements. In regions the place groundwater is closely relied upon, such violations can significantly hurt public health and the environment by introducing nitrates and pathogens into water provides.

Chemical interactions between household waste and the surrounding soil additionally play a job in assessing the environmental impact of septic methods. Household cleaners, pharmaceuticals, and personal hygiene merchandise can disrupt the pure microbial processes in a septic system, resulting in inadequate treatment of wastewater. This not only results in system failure but in addition allows dangerous chemical substances and pathogens to flee into the environment.


The broader ecological ramifications of septic methods can be significantly pronounced in delicate environments such as coastal areas and lakes. Nutrient loading from malfunctioning systems can result in algal blooms, which deplete oxygen ranges in water bodies and trigger fish kills. These blooms also can produce toxins harmful to aquatic life and humans, impacting leisure activities and native economies.


Septic methods also can contribute to habitat degradation. Runoff from failing systems can harm close by wetlands, affecting the fragile biodiversity these ecosystems assist. As wildlife populations decline, the impact ripples by way of the meals chain, further disrupting ecosystems already confused by local weather change and urban growth.

Adopting advanced septic technologies can mitigate a few of these environmental impacts. Enhanced treatment techniques use additional processes like aeration or filtration to enhance wastewater treatment. While these systems are usually more costly, they offer the next stage of protection towards groundwater contamination and produce effluent that is much less dangerous to the environment.


Legislation and policy frameworks play a vital role in regulating septic methods. Implementing stricter oversight and inspection requirements might help ensure that methods are functioning appropriately. Group teaching programs would additionally promote accountable septic system possession, emphasizing the necessity for regular maintenance and reporting issues promptly.

How does soil sort influence the effectiveness of a septic system?


Soil sort significantly influences a septic system's effectiveness. Sandy soils sometimes permit for higher drainage and nutrient absorption, whereas clay soils can result in poor drainage and a better danger of system failure. Understanding soil traits is important throughout web site evaluations for septic techniques.

Alternative wastewater treatment choices include aerobic treatment items, mound methods, and constructed wetlands. These techniques can be more practical in certain environments or for properties with difficult soil conditions, typically offering a lower environmental impact when designed and maintained correctly.
